Abstract

A parameter estimation algorithm which can be applied to the adaptive control of linear systems is presented. The algorithm is basically the least squares algorithm but includes a dead zone, a modification operator and a forgetting factor. Modification operator is a formulation of so-called soft constraints of the estimates. Projection can be regarded as a special case of modification operator. For the calculation of forgetting factor, Ydstie and Sargent's formula based on the constant information principle is modified so that it can be applied to the plant model with unmodelled plant uncertainties and external disturbances. It is shown that the proposed algorithm retains some important properties of the standard recursive least squares algorithm which are crucial in proving the closed-loop stability.
